PERFORMANCE/REFERENCE CHECKS ATTACHMENTS System of Award Managment (SAM) YES Convicted Vendor List NO Debarred Contractors NO Suspended Contractors NO Suspended Vendors -State: NO Scrutinized Companies List: NO Google Search: YES Upload Clear Upload Clear Upload Clear Upload Clear Upload Clear Upload Clear Upload Clear ABS SAM.pdf Convicted Vendor List ABS.pdf contractor -debarment ABS.pdf MDC ABS.pdf Suspended Vendor List ABS.pdf ABS prohibited_list.pdf civil and criminal litigation ABS.pdf McLaren Richard Digitally signed by McLaren, Richard Date: 2026.04.08 11:27:35 -04'00' STATE BOARD OF ADMINISTRATION OF FLORIDA 1801 HERMITAGE BOULEVARD, SUITE 100 TALLAHASSEE, FLORIDA 32308 (850) 488-4406 POST OFFICE BOX 13300 32317-3300 Protecting Florida's Investments Act "Scrutinized Companies" Chapter 287.135, Florida Statutes RON DESANTIS GOVERNOR CHAIR BLAISE INGOGLL4 CHIEF FINANCIAL OFFICER JAMES UTHMEIER ATTORNEY GENERAL CHRIS SPENCER E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R Chapter 287.135, Florida Statutes was created effective July 1, 2011, and prohibits a company on the Scrutinized Companies with Activities in Sudan List or on the Scrutinized Companies with Activities in the Iran Terrorism Sectors List from bidding on, submitting a proposal for, or entering into or renewing a contract with an agency or local governmental entity for goods or services of $1 million or more. Pursuant to Chapter 215.473, Florida Statutes, the Florida State Board of Administration is charged with maintaining a complete list of scrutinized companies. Scrutinized companies are judged according to whether they meet the following criteria: Sudan: 1. Have a material business relationship with the government of Sudan or a government -created project involving oil related, mineral extraction, or power generation activities, or 2. Have a material business relationship involving the supply of military equipment, or 3. Impart minimal benefit to disadvantaged citizens that are typically located in the geographic periphery of Sudan, or 4. Have been complicit in the genocidal campaign in Darfur. Iran: 1. Have a material business relationship with the government of Iran or a government -created project involving oil related or mineral extraction activities, or the energy, petrochemical, financial, construction, manufacturing, textile, mining, metals, shipping, shipbuilding, or port sectors of Iran, or 2. Have made material investments with the effect of significantly enhancing Iran`s petroleum sector. The SBA is not responsible for compliance with Chapter 287.135, Florida Statutes. The SBA's responsibilities are solely focused on the Protecting Florida's Investments Act and Chapter 215.473 as it relates to the identification of "Scrutinized Companies" that have prohibited business operations in Sudan or Iran. The table on the following pages provides the List of Prohibited Investments (Scrutinized Companies). This list is updated as part of the Protecting Florida's Investments Act (PFIA) and the Global Governance Mandates Quarterly Report, upon review and approval by the Trustees of the State Board of Administration. SOFTWARE LICENSE AGREEMENT This agreement (the "Agreement") with an effective date of March 3, 2026, (the "Effective Date") is entered between Applied Business Software, Inc., a Delaware corporation with a place of business at 7755 Center Avenue, Suite 800, Huntington Beach, California 92647 ("Licensor"), and City of Miami, a Florida Government Agency, having a taxpayer identification number 59-6000375 and on the date of this Agreement a place of business at 444 SW 2nd Avenue, Miami, Florida 33130 United States and an e-mail address of fvega@miamigov.com ("Licensee"). RECITALS A. Licensee desires to obtain a license from Licensor for the Software described herein, having serial number 001-8147-000 (collectively the `Software"). B. Licensor is willing to grant a license to Licensee for the Software, pursuant and subject to the terms and conditions of this Agreement including the General Terms and Conditions ("GTC") attached hereto as exhibit "A" and made a part of this Agreement. In consideration of these premises, and the mutual promises and conditions in the Agreement the parties agree as follows: 1. Software Description: The Mortgage Office (SQL) - consisting of The Mortgage Office core program, the Database and the following modules: Loan Servicing; Trust Fund Accounting; Financial Calculator; ACH Express; Web Publishing Central; Tax Forms Management & Printing; Document Manager; Escrow Administration; Loan Origination including the following document packages: US Private Lending. 2. Designated Location: Not Applicable. 3. License Model: SaaS. 4. Total Number of Computers: 7. 5. Counterparts. This Agreement may be executed in counterparts. For purposes hereof, a facsimile copy or a scanned and e-mailed copy of this Agreement, including the signature page hereto, shall be deemed to be an original. SOFTWARE LICENSE AGREEMENT GENERAL TERMS AND CONDITIONS These General Terms and Conditions ("GTC") is entered into between Applied Business Software, Inc., a California corporation, with a place of business located at 7755 Center Avenue, Suite 800, Huntington Beach, California 92647 ("Licensor") and ("Licensee") which means you or the legal entity you are executing this GTC on behalf of. By you executing this GTC on behalf of the legal entity, you represent that you have the legal authority to bind that legal entity to this GTC for their use of the software ("Software") as set forth in the latest fully executed Software License Agreement between Licensor and Licensee (the "Agreement"). Please review the terms of this GTC thoroughly. This GTC constitutes a legal agreement between Licensee and Licensor. By executing a hard copy of this GTC, Licensee is accepting all the terms and conditions of this GTC and the Agreement. License Model: Perpetual The following General Terms and Conditions apply to a Perpetual License as set forth in the Agreement. 1. In consideration of Licensee's agreement to abide by the terms and conditions of the Agreement, and subject to the other restrictions contained in this GTC and the payment by Licensee of Licensor's current license fees for the Software, Licensor hereby grants to Licensee, and Licensee hereby accepts, a non-exclusive, non -transferable license to install the Software, in object code form only, and only in accordance with the terms and conditions of this Agreement. This is a Per Device license and not a Concurrent license. 2. No other Computer may access the Software except that if the Total Number of Computers as set forth in the Agreement is greater than 1, Licensee may install the Software on a Terminal Server located at the Designated Location for remote use of the Software on individually identifiable Computers located at locations other than the Designated Location, provided that Licensee adheres to all of the other provisions of this GTC and the Agreement and provided the total number of Computers on which the Software is installed or from which it is accessed does not exceed the number set forth in the Agreement. Any Terminal Server that is running the Software counts as one of the Total Number of Computers set forth in the Agreement. Computers at the Designated Location may not access the Software via the Terminal Server. A Terminal Server is any type of Computer on which the Software can be installed, and which may connect with other Computers, terminals, workstations, servers and/or routers to allow use of the Software by any such Computer. Licensee may not have the Software hosted by a third -party hosting service other than any third -party hosting service that may be offered by Licensor to Licensee. 3. If a Computer on which the Software is installed is replaced for any reason, and the Software is permanently deleted from such Computer, Licensee may install the Software on another Computer which will become the new assigned Computer for the Software. If a Computer that remotely accesses the Software is replaced for any reason and will never again access the Software, an individually identifiable remote replacement Computer may access the Software in place of the replaced remote Computer. 4. Term and Termination. The term of the Agreement and the license granted thereunder shall begin as of the Effective Date and shall remain in force until terminated by either party as provided herein. The Agreement and the license granted therein shall automatically terminate upon the breach by Licensee of any of the provisions of the Agreement. Licensor may suspend Licensee's rights to utilize the Software during any time Licensee is delinquent in its payments to Licensor pursuant to any agreements between Licensee and Licensor, including, but not limited to, any Software Maintenance and Support Agreement between Licensee and Licensor or any such agreements have not been executed by Licensee and received by Licensor within 30 days of their being mailed by Licensor to Licensee. Licensee may terminate the Agreement at any time by providing written notice thereof to the Licensor. Rev. 20250220 Page 2 of 13 5. Effect of Termination. Within ten (10) days after the date of termination of the Agreement for any reason, Licensee shall return all original copies of the Software and give Licensor written notice certifying that the original copies of the Software and any other material received from Licensor in connection with this Agreement have been returned to Licensor, and that the Software has been erased from all computer memories and storage devices within Licensee's control and that Licensee has not retained any copies of the Software. In addition to all other remedies available to Licensor under the Agreement, Licensor shall be entitled to specific performance of Licensee's obligations to return and erase the Software and other materials licensed under the Agreement. 6. Rev. 20250220 Page 3 of 13 License Model: SaaS The following General Terms and Conditions apply to a SaaS License as set forth in the Agreement. 15. Licensor grants Licensee a renewable, nonexclusive, royalty -free, and worldwide right as set forth in the Agreement and subject to the other restrictions contained in this GTC to access the Software Concurrently on the Total Number of Computers as set forth in the Agreement via the SaaS. This is a Concurrent license. Licensor may change, discontinue or deprecate any of the Software or SaaS (including the Software and SaaS as a whole) or change or remove features or functionality of the Software or SaaS from time to time. 16. Control and Location of SaaS. The method and means of providing the SaaS shall be under the exclusive control of Licensor. 17. Other Internet Based Services. Licensor may provide other Internet based services (the "Other Services") to be used in conjunction with the SaaS services. Licensor may charge an additional fee or fees to Licensee for Licensees' use of any of these Other Services. Licensor may change or cancel these Other Services at any time. 18. Support; Maintenance. 18.1. Services Covered by the SaaS license ("Services"). (a) Telephone Consultation. Licensor shall provide to Licensee telephone consultation with respect to the use and operation of the Software, Monday through Friday between the hours of 9:00 AM and 6:00 PM (Pacific time zone), excluding all Licensor holidays ("Business Hours"). If support personnel are unavailable at the time Licensee calls during Business Hours, Licensor will use commercially reasonable efforts to return the call no later than the end of the next business day following the business day in which the call was received. Licensor is obligated to provide a maximum of eight (8) hours of telephone consultation per month. If Licensor agrees, in its sole discretion, to provide additional hours of telephone consultation in any given month, Licensee will be charged and agrees to pay Licensor's then current hourly rate for such telephone consultation. (b) Provision of Upgrades. Licensor shall provide Licensee with enhancements, updates and new versions of the Software (collectively, "Upgrades"), if any, generally released by Licensor during the term of this Agreement. Such Upgrades will be provided at no additional charge to Licensee. Any Upgrades furnished pursuant to this Agreement shall be considered "Software" under this Agreement and shall be licensed to Licensee pursuant and subject to the terms and conditions of this Agreement. 18.2. Services Not Covered by the SaaS license. (a) Exclusions. Licensor shall have no obligation to provide Services for any hardware used by Licensee in connection with use of the Software or for any request for services caused by: (i) the improper use, alteration, or damage of the Software; (ii) modifications to the Software not made by Licensor; (iii) application or other software not provided or approved by Licensor; (iv) use of the Software on hardware that has not been approved by Licensor for use with the Software; (v) failure to meet the system requirements for the then current version of the Software; or (v) hardware failures. (b) Scope of Services. This GTC and the Agreement only covers the Services described in this GTC and Agreement and does not include other services, including without limitation: (a) Software customization; (b) custom development of software; or (c) training of Licensee's Rev. 20250220 Page 4 of 13 personnel in the use of the Software. Licensor may agree, in its sole discretion, to provide such other services pursuant to a separate written agreement between the parties, and for a separate charge. (c) Back Version Support. Licensor shall only be obligated to provide Services for Software corresponding to the most recent Upgrade; provided, however, Licensor may provide back version support for a limited period of time, in its sole discretion. 18.3. Licensee Obligations. Licensor agrees to provide the Services hereunder only if Licensee meets all of the following conditions and obligations: (a) the Software is used in the form in which Licensor originally supplied it, plus all Upgrades delivered by Licensor to Licensee; (b) the Software is and has been at all times used in a proper manner and in accordance with the instructions and documentation supplied by Licensor; (c) Licensee has agreed to and is in compliance with the GTC and Agreement; and (d) Licensee is in compliance with all of the terms and conditions of this GTC and Agreement. License Model: Hosted and SaaS The following General Terms and Conditions apply to Hosted and SaaS Licenses as set forth in the Agreement. 19. Term and Termination; Renewals. 19.1. Term. Unless this GTC and Agreement are terminated earlier in accordance with the terms set forth herein, (the "Initial Term") shall commence on the Effective Date and continue until twelve months after the Effective Date. Following the Initial Term and unless otherwise terminated as provided for in this GTC and Agreement, this GTC and Agreement shall automatically renew for successive one (1) year terms (each, a "Renewal Term") until such time as a party provides the other party with written notice of termination; provided, however, that: (a) such notice be given no fewer than thirty (30) calendar days prior to the last day of the then -current term; and, (b) any such termination shall be effective as of the date that would have been the first day of the next Renewal Term. This GTC and Agreement shall automatically terminate upon the breach by Licensee of any of the provisions of this GTC or Agreement. 19.2. Payments upon Termination. Upon the termination of this GTC or Agreement, Licensee shall immediately pay to Licensor all amounts due and payable under this GTC and Agreement, if any, through the end of the then current Term. 20. The latest Quote executed by the parties contains the prices and services to be provided by Licensor to Licensee herein. 21. Fees; Renewals; Billing. 21.1. Fees. Licensee shall be responsible for, and shall pay to Licensor, the fees as described in the latest executed quote between Licensor and Licensee (the "Quote") subject to the terms and conditions contained in this GTC, the Agreement, and the Quote. 21.2. Renewals. Should the SaaS or Hosted continue beyond the then -current Term, the SaaS and/or Hosted Fees for the Renewal Term may be increased by notice from Licensor to Licensee no later than thirty (30) calendar days from the expiration of the then Initial Term or the then Renewal Term. 21.3. Billing. Any sum due Licensor for the SaaS and/or Hosted for which payment is not otherwise specified shall be due and payable in full without any deduction or offset within fifteen (15) calendar days after the date of the invoice from Licensor to Licensee. Rev. 20250220 Page 7 of 13 33. License Metering, Auditing and Data Analytics. 33.1. Licensee acknowledges and understands that the Software has a built-in license metering module. The Software may periodically prompt the user to validate the copies of the Software installed on each computer. Licensee will have fifteen (15) days to respond to a validation prompt. If Licensor does not receive a response to the validation prompt within this 15-day period, the Software will disable itself and will become inoperable. 33.2. Licensee acknowledges that: (i) the Software may use Licensee's internal network for license metering of installed versions of the Software; (ii) the Software may use Licensee's internal network and Internet connections for the purpose of transmitting license -related data to Licensor. Licensee further acknowledges that such information may be used by Licensor for validating the authenticity of the license and monitoring the license -related data, in order to protect the Software against unlicensed or illegal use of the Software. Licensee further acknowledges that license auditing and Software activation is based on the exchange of license related data between Licensee's computers and Licensor's server. Licensee must have an active Internet connection to receive the necessary Installation, Upgrade or License Update codes. 33.3. Licensee acknowledges and agrees that Licensor will automatically receive license metering and compliance information from the built-in metering module set forth in this Section 36. Licensee agrees to follow any applicable requirements of this Agreement related to its use of the Software. 33.4. Licensee acknowledges and agrees that notwithstanding any metering module or other measures put in place by Licensor, Licensee is solely responsible and liable for any and all violations and breaches of this Agreement, whether intentional or unintentional. 33.5. Licensee acknowledges and agrees that Licensee shall not take any action to circumvent the license metering module or to delete, modify or configure any data so as to prevent the accurate reporting from the license metering module. 33.6. Licensor has the right to access customer data for analytical purposes to calculate metrics, loan volumes and related information and may utilize such information internally and in sales and marketing efforts. Licensor shall not identify any specific loans or lender or borrower information. 34. Ownership and Confidentiality. Public Records — Chapter 119, Florida Statutes 2.1. Licensor acknowledges that Licensee is a public agency subject to Florida's Public Records Law, Chapter 119, Florida Statutes, and Article I, Section 24 of the Florida Constitution. Licensor understands that documents, data, and other materials in Licensor's possession in connection with the Agreement may constitute "public records" subject to inspection and copying. 2.2. To the extent Licensor is acting on behalf of Licensee as provided in section 119.0701, Florida Statutes, Licensor shall: 2.3. Keep and maintain public records that are ordinarily and necessarily required by Licensee to perform the services under the Agreement; 2.3.1.Provide the public with access to such public records on reasonable terms and conditions and at a cost that does not exceed that allowed by Chapter 119, Florida Statutes, or other applicable law; 2.3.2.Ensure that public records that are exempt or confidential and exempt from disclosure are not disclosed except as authorized by law; 2.3.3.Upon request from Licensee's custodian of public records, promptly provide copies of any requested public records or allow the records to be inspected or copied within a reasonable time; and 2.3.4.Upon termination of the Agreement, transfer to Licensee, at no cost, all public records in Licensor's possession related to the Agreement and, if directed by Licensee, destroy any duplicate records that are exempt or confidential and exempt from disclosure requirements. All electronically stored public records must be provided in a format that is compatible with Licensee's information technology systems. 2.3.5.SHOULD LICENSOR DETERMINE TO DISPUTE ANY PUBLIC ACCESS PROVISION REQUIRED BY FLORIDA STATUTES IN CONNECTION WITH THIS AGREEMENT, THEN LICENSOR SHALL DO SO AT ITS OWN EXPENSE AND AT NO COST TO LICENSEE (THE CITY OF MIAMI). IF LICENSOR HAS QUESTIONS REGARDING Docusign Envelope ID: 02041 F8F-F815-876A-82E3-7613C0C92255 THE APPLICATION OF CHAPTER 119, FLORIDA STATUTES, TO LICENSOR'S DUTY TO PROVIDE PUBLIC RECORDS RELATING TO THIS AGREEMENT, LICENSOR MAY CONTACT THE CUSTODIAN OF PUBLIC RECORDS AT (305) 416- 1800, VIA EMAIL AT PUBLICRECORDS@MIAMIGOV.COM, OR BY REGULAR MAIL AT CITY OF MIAMI, OFFICE OF THE CITY ATTORNEY, 444 SW 2ND AVENUE, 9TH FLOOR, MIAMI, FL 33130. LICENSOR MAY ALSO CONTACT THE RECORDS CUSTODIAN AT THE CITY OF MIAMI DEPARTMENT THAT IS ADMINISTERING THIS AGREEMENT. 2.4. Licensor's failure to comply with this section shall be a material breach of the Agreement and grounds for immediate unilateral termination by Licensee, in addition to any other remedies available at law or in equity. If Licensor fails to provide public records upon request, Licensor shall reimburse Licensee for any costs and attorneys' fees incurred by Licensee in enforcing the requirements of Chapter 119, Florida Statutes, as they relate to records of Licensor. 3. Maintenance of Records; Audit and Inspection Rights 3.1. Licensor shall keep and maintain complete and accurate books, records, documents, and other evidence (collectively, "Records") that relate to: (i) fees and charges billed to Licensee; (ii) performance of services under the Agreement; and (iii) security and access controls applied to Licensee's data. 3.2. Licensor shall retain all Records for at least five (5) years after the later of: (i) expiration or earlier termination of the Agreement; or (ii) the resolution of any audit, claim, or litigation arising out of the Agreement. 3.3. Licensee, the City of Miami's Independent Inspector General, and any other duly authorized representative of Licensee shall have the right, upon reasonable notice and during normal business hours, to inspect, audit, and copy such Records at Licensor's place of business, or to receive copies electronically at no additional cost, for the purpose of verifying charges and compliance with the Agreement. 3.4. If any audit reveals overcharges to Licensee, Licensor shall promptly refund the overcharged amounts with interest at the maximum rate allowed by law. If an audit reveals a material breach or non-compliance, Licensee may recover its reasonable audit costs in addition to other remedies. 4. Contingency Clause; Availability of Funds; Non -Appropriation 4.1. Funding for Licensee's obligations under the Agreement is contingent upon the availability of lawfully appropriated funds and continued authorization for the program or project for which the Software and services are procured. 4.2. If funds are not appropriated, or are reduced, or if program authorization is reduced or terminated, Licensee may, in its sole discretion, amend the Agreement to reduce the scope of services or terminate the Agreement, in whole or in part, upon thirty (30) days' written notice to Licensor. 4.3. In such event, Licensee shall have no obligation to pay any early termination fee, liquidated damages, or other penalty. Licensee shall only be obligated to pay undisputed fees for Software access and services actually provided through the effective date of termination, subject to applicable budgetary limitations. 5. Data Security; City Data Ownership; Limitation on Analytics Use 14.1. All data, content, and information of Licensee and its customers or program beneficiaries that is entered into, processed, generated, or stored through the Software or SaaS ("City Data") shall be and remain the exclusive property of Licensee. Licensor shall have no ownership or other proprietary interest in City Data. Docusign Envelope ID: 02041 F8F-F815-876A-82E3-7613C0C92255 14.2. Use of City Data. Licensor may use City Data solely to provide the Software, SaaS, and related services to Licensee, to maintain and improve such services, and to meet its legal obligations. Licensor shall not sell City Data, use City Data to market to third parties, or use City Data in a manner that would identify Licensee or any individual data subject in sales or marketing efforts, even if aggregated, without Licensee's prior written consent. This provision supersedes any contrary language in the Agreement Documents. 14.3. Security Measures. Licensor shall implement and maintain commercially reasonable administrative, physical, and technical safeguards designed to: (i) ensure the security and confidentiality of City Data; (ii) protect against anticipated threats or hazards to the security or integrity of City Data; and (iii) protect against unauthorized access to or use of City Data. 14.4. Security Incidents. Licensor shall promptly (and in no event later than seventy-two (72) hours after discovery) notify Licensee in writing of any actual or reasonably suspected unauthorized access, acquisition, use, disclosure, or destruction of City Data, or other security incident that may materially impact Licensee or its constituents. Licensor shall cooperate fully with Licensee in investigating and remediating any such incident, including providing relevant logs and records, and shall bear costs to the extent required by applicable law or attributable to Licensor's failure to comply with this section. 14.5. Return / Retention of City Data. Upon expiration or termination of the Agreement for any reason, Licensor shall, at Licensee's option, (i) provide Licensee a complete and current export of City Data in a mutually agreed, non-proprietary, machine-readable format; and (ii) thereafter securely delete or render unreadable all City Data in its possession or control, except where retention is required by law. 15.
